Transaction 2965416a6bc84be141371a5aadc71c71d81b33acec521d1a1043c45c855fc0a4
1 Input
1 Output
-
2965416a6bc84be141371a5aadc71c71d81b33acec521d1a1043c45c855fc0a4:0
- value
- 52133
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 686fadfa876d627fe6e911b7745ee1cbbdd1c19b916053fed47c1e13f38bd726
- address
- bc1pdph6m758d438lehfzxmhghhpew7arsvmj9s98lk50s0p8uut6unq5xx59l